Ordinals
beta
Sat 792001908403013
decimal
158400.1908403013
degree
0°158400′1152″1908403013‴
percentile
37.7143766321055%
name
ifwnephinzg
cycle
0
epoch
0
period
78
block
158400
offset
1908403013
timestamp
2011-12-21 04:01:05 UTC
rarity
common
prev
next